In re:

Repeal of subdivision (b) of subdivision 55.03, entitled "Signing of Pleadings, Motions and Other Papers; Appearance and Withdrawal of Counsel; Representations to Court; Sanctions," of Rule 55, entitled "Pleadings, Motions, and Hearings," and in lieu thereof adoption of a new subdivision (b) of subdivision 55.03, entitled "Signing of Pleadings, Motions and Other Papers; Appearance and Withdrawal of Counsel; Representations to Court; Sanctions."

ORDER

1.  It is ordered that, effective January 1, 2023, subdivision (b) of subdivision 55.03 of Rule 55 be and the same is hereby repealed and a new subdivision (b) of subdivision 55.03 is adopted in lieu thereof to read as follows:

55.03  SIGNING OF PLEADINGS, MOTIONS AND OTHER PAPERS; APPEARANCE AND WITHDRAWAL OF COUNSEL; REPRESENTATIONS TO COURT; SANCTIONS

*     *     *

(b) Entry of Appearance of Counsel. An attorney who appears in a case shall be considered as representing the parties for whom the attorney appears for all purposes in that case, except as otherwise provided in a written entry of limited appearance. If an entry of limited appearance is filed, service shall be made as provided in Rule 43.01(b).

An attorney appears in a case by:

(1) Participating in any proceeding as counsel for any party unless limited by an entry of limited appearance;

(2) Signing the attorney's name on any pleading, motion, or other filing; however, if an attorney is identified on a pleading, motion, or other filing as having only assisted in the preparation of the pleading, motion, or other filing, the attorney has not entered an appearance in the matter; or

(3) Filing a written entry of appearance. A written entry of appearance may be limited by its terms to a particular proceeding or matter and may be further limited to a particular time or for a particular purpose within that proceeding or matter. If so limited, the written entry of appearance shall be titled "Entry of Limited Appearance" and shall state the physical and mailing addresses, telephone number, facsimile number, and electronic mail address, if any, of each person for whom the attorney is making a limited appearance.
